Q2
Under Alabama Mechanics' Lien law, an original contractor (one having a direct
contract with the property owner) must file a verified statement of lien in the office of
the Judge of Probate within how many months after the last item of work was
performed?
A) 3 months
B) 4 months
C) 6 months
D) 12 months
Correct Answer: C) 6 months
Explanation: Pursuant to Code of Alabama § 35-11-215, an original contractor has 6
months from the date of the last item of work or material furnished to file their verified lien
statement. (Subcontractors have 4 months, and journeymen/laborers have 30 days).

Q5
Under OSHA standards (29 CFR 1926.652), at what trench depth is a protective
system (sloping, benching, or trench shield/shoring) mandatory for worker entry,
assuming the soil is not stable rock?
, A) $3\text{ feet}$
B) $4\text{ feet}$
C) $5\text{ feet}$
D) $6\text{ feet}$
Correct Answer: C) 5 feet
Explanation: OSHA requires protective systems (shoring, shielding, or sloping) in all
excavations/trenches that reach a depth of $5\text{ feet}$ or greater, unless the
excavation is made entirely in stable rock.
Q6
What type of insurance protects a residential builder against financial losses
resulting from accidental property damage or third-party bodily injury occurring on a
job site during construction?
A) Commercial General Liability (CGL)
B) Builder's Risk Insurance
C) Errors and Omissions (E&O)
D) Workers' Compensation
Correct Answer: A) Commercial General Liability (CGL)
Explanation: Commercial General Liability covers third-party bodily injury and property
damage resulting from construction operations. (Builder's Risk covers physical damage to
the structure itself from fire/wind/vandalism).
